Antipsychotic Lab Monitoring Information Update

Did you know that glucose and lipid labs are required annually for youth patients who are prescribed antipsychotic medications? Also, a comprehensive metabolic panel (CMP) does NOT include lipids, so ordering a CMP does NOT fulfill the American Diabetes Association recommendation1 (or the HEDIS metric2) for prescribing antipsychotic medications!

Recently an EHR Best Practice Alert was developed to help remind prescribers to order both glucose AND lipid labs annually. We have a Quality Improvement Coach on staff who can work with practices to improve Antipsychotic Lab Monitoring outcomes, including the Best Practice Alert.
